noun 
  1. An act of whirling.
    She gave the top a whirl and it spun across the floor.
  2. Something that whirls.
  3. A confused tumult.
  4. A rapid series of events
    My life is one social .
  5. Dizziness or giddiness.
    1. {{context, usually following "give") A brief experiment or trial.
    OK, let's give it a .
verb 
  1. (intransitive) To rotate, revolve, spin or turn rapidly.
The dancer whirled across the stage, stopped, and whirled around to face the audience.
  1. (intransitive) To have a sensation of spinning or reeling.
My head is whirling after all that drink.
  1. (transitive) To make something or someone whirl.
The dancer whirled his partner round on her toes.
